编程学成什么样可以去面试

fiy 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程领域,学成什么样才能去面试是一个非常重要的问题。下面我将为你详细介绍一些可以帮助你准备面试的学习内容和技能。

    1. 编程基础知识:作为一个程序员,你需要掌握基本的编程语言,如Java、Python、C++等。了解变量、数据类型、运算符、控制流程等基本概念,能够编写简单的程序,并理解基本的算法和数据结构。

    2. 网络和操作系统:了解计算机网络和操作系统的基本知识。掌握TCP/IP协议、HTTP协议等网络基础知识,了解操作系统的概念、进程管理、内存管理等基本原理。

    3. 数据库:掌握SQL语言和关系型数据库的基本概念和操作。了解数据库设计、索引、事务等相关知识。

    4. Web开发:熟悉前端开发技术,如HTML、CSS、JavaScript等。了解前端框架,如React、Vue等。同时,对后端开发也要有一定的了解,熟悉常用的后端开发语言和框架,如Java Spring、Python Django等。

    5. 数据结构与算法:掌握常见的数据结构,如数组、链表、栈、队列、树等,并能够应用它们解决实际问题。了解常见的算法,如排序、搜索、图算法等。

    6. 软件工程和项目管理:了解软件开发的基本流程和方法,熟悉常用的开发工具和技术,如版本控制系统、集成开发环境等。同时,了解项目管理的基本原理和方法,能够有效地组织和管理项目。

    7. 解决问题的能力:在面试中,解决问题的能力非常重要。学会分析问题、提出解决方案,并能够清晰地表达自己的想法。

    除了以上的学习内容和技能,还要不断地学习和提升自己。参加编程竞赛、做开源项目、阅读相关的技术书籍和博客等,都可以帮助你提高编程能力。最重要的是,在实践中不断地学习和积累经验,才能在面试中展现出自己的实力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    当你学会编程并准备去面试时,以下几个方面是非常重要的:

    1. 扎实的编程基础知识:面试官通常会问一些基础的编程问题,包括数据类型、变量、循环、条件语句等。你需要熟悉至少一种编程语言,并了解常见的编程概念和语法。此外,你还需要了解计算机科学的基本概念,例如算法和数据结构。

    2. 解决问题的能力:编程是解决问题的工具,面试官会考察你解决问题的能力。他们可能会提供一些编程题目,要求你用编程语言解决。在解决问题时,你需要思考问题的本质、设计合理的解决方案,并编写可读性高且高效的代码。

    3. 项目经验:在准备面试时,你应该有一些实际的项目经验来展示自己的能力。这些项目可以是个人项目、开源项目或在校期间完成的项目。你需要能够清晰地描述项目的目标、你的角色和贡献,并展示你在项目中所学到的技术和解决问题的能力。

    4. 持续学习的态度:技术行业发展迅速,新的编程语言、框架和工具不断涌现。面试官会关注你是否具有持续学习的能力和意愿。你可以通过参与在线课程、阅读技术博客、参加技术社区活动等方式展示自己的学习能力。

    5. 沟通和团队合作能力:虽然编程是一个个人的技能,但在工作中,你通常需要与团队成员合作。面试官会关注你的沟通和团队合作能力。你需要能够清晰地表达自己的想法,与团队成员合作解决问题,并在团队中承担一定的责任。

    总之,准备面试时,除了具备扎实的编程知识外,你还需要展示解决问题的能力、项目经验、持续学习的态度以及沟通和团队合作能力。这些方面将帮助你在面试中脱颖而出,并获得心仪的编程工作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程学成什么样可以去面试

    面试是程序员求职过程中非常重要的一环,通过面试,企业可以了解到应聘者的技术水平、工作经验和解决问题的能力。那么,编程学成什么样才能够去面试呢?以下是一些关键点,可以作为参考:

    1. 掌握基本的编程语言和数据结构:作为一名程序员,至少需要掌握一门编程语言,如Python、Java、C++等,并熟悉常用的数据结构和算法,如数组、链表、栈、队列、树等。在面试中,这些基本知识是必备的。

    2. 理解面向对象编程(OOP)的概念和原则:OOP是现代编程中的一种主要范式,面试中经常会涉及到与OOP相关的问题。因此,了解OOP的概念和原则,并能够在实际项目中应用,是非常重要的。

    3. 熟悉常用的开发工具和框架:在实际工作中,开发工具和框架可以极大地提高开发效率。因此,熟悉常用的开发工具(如IDE、版本控制工具等)和框架(如Spring、Django等)是很有帮助的。

    4. 具备实际项目经验:在面试中,有实际项目经验是非常有竞争力的。通过实际项目,可以锻炼自己的编程能力和解决问题的能力,同时也可以展示自己的工作态度和团队合作能力。

    5. 具备良好的沟通和团队合作能力:作为一名程序员,与他人的沟通和团队合作是非常重要的。在面试中,通过与面试官的交流和合作,展示自己的沟通能力和团队合作能力,是能否得到录用的重要因素。

    在准备面试时,可以参考以下方法和操作流程:

    1. 研究招聘公司和职位要求:在面试前,需要对招聘公司和职位要求进行充分的了解。了解招聘公司的业务领域、技术栈和团队文化,同时研究职位要求,明确自己是否满足招聘要求。

    2. 复习基础知识和常见面试题:面试中经常会涉及到基础知识和常见面试题,因此需要对基础知识进行复习,并准备一些常见面试题的答案。可以通过查阅相关书籍、教程和网上资源进行复习。

    3. 实践编程技能:除了理论知识外,实践编程技能也非常重要。可以通过参与开源项目、完成个人项目或者刷题来提升编程能力。在面试中,可以通过展示自己的项目经验和解决问题的能力来证明自己的实践能力。

    4. 制定面试策略:在面试前,可以制定一个面试策略,明确自己的优势和劣势,并为可能的面试问题做好准备。可以在面试前进行模拟面试,提前预演面试场景,以增加自信心。

    5. 注意面试礼仪和形象:在面试中,除了技术能力外,面试官也会考察应聘者的面试礼仪和形象。因此,在面试前需要注意穿着得体、言谈举止得体,并保持良好的沟通态度。

    总之,编程学成什么样才能去面试取决于个人的学习和实践经验。通过不断学习和实践,提升自己的编程能力和解决问题的能力,同时注重沟通和团队合作能力的培养,可以增加自己在面试中的竞争力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部